②每隔n个位置从图像数据中提取一个数据,组成新的图像数据,得到数据是原来的n分之一 。
③把新的图像数据生成图片
代码如下:
Dim Path = "/sdcard/pictures/f.jpg"Dim NewPath = "/sdcard/pictures/f1.jpg"dim PicSize = Image.Size(Path)Dim x=PicSize[1]Dim y=PicSize[2]Dim n=5 //缩放倍数Dim PixelData =https://www.520longzhigu.com/diannao/Image.GetPicData(Path)Dim NewPixelData= Image.GetScreenData(1,1,int(x/n),int(y/n))For j = 1 To int(x/n)For i = 1 To int(y/n)For k = 1 To 3NewPixelData[j][i][k]=PixelData[j*5][i*5][k]NextNextNextImage.SavePixelData NewPixelData, NewPath
效果展示:
代码里面有个缩放倍数变量,你可以直接修改成你需要的倍数,原本想把截图缩放也写一下,后来想想,那不就是先截图保存下来,然后在把图片缩放吗,原理都一样,就没必要写了 。
以上关于本文的内容,仅作参考!温馨提示:如遇健康、疾病相关的问题,请您及时就医或请专业人士给予相关指导!
「四川龙网」www.sichuanlong.com小编还为您精选了以下内容,希望对您有所帮助:- 买手机还在选苹果 买手机苹果版好还是安卓版好
- 如何通过屏幕大按钮控制手机 手机电话按键怎么放大
- 天猫精灵有什么功能 天猫精灵是什么
- 大哥大按键机也可刷抖音和微信
- 小米手机按键隐藏的3个功能 小米怎么隐藏按键
- 鱼龙王
- 小米K40游戏手机 小米K40游戏手机游戏按键有什么用
- 按键精灵好用 按键精灵怎么用啊
- 都市精灵
- 魔兽世界怀旧服精灵怎么去暴风城 暴风城怎么去铁炉堡